Oilers' Khaira suspended 2 games for cross-checking

Icon Sportswire / Getty

Edmonton Oilers forward Jujhar Khaira has been suspended two games for his cross-check on St. Louis Blues defenseman Vince Dunn, the NHL's Department of Player Safety announced on Wednesday.

The incident occurred midway through the third period of Tuesday's game. Khaira was assessed a five-minute major for cross-checking and a match penalty.

Earlier in the day, Dunn was fined $1,942.20 for his cross-check to Khaira in the same sequence.

Khaira will be eligible to return to the Oilers' lineup on Dec. 29 when the club hosts the San Jose Sharks. In 33 games this season, the 24-year-old has two goals and 11 assists.
